How to survive the flight to Montagne?
Wherever you’re jetting in from, flying can be a pleasant experience if you prepare well enough. Follow these handy travel tips that will get your Montagne escape started on the right note.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The trick to having an awesome flight experience is to pack in advance. First up, the essentials: passport, travel docs, credit cards and daily medications. Next, bring items that’ll help keep you entertained, like your laptop or a good read. It’s also a wise idea to bring your chargers, a comfy neck pillow and a pair of earplugs. Last but not least, don’t forget to squeeze in toiletries like a toothbrush, facial wipes and a clean T-shirt.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of prohibited items can differ between airlines, the general rule of thumb is nothing s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es box cutters, razor blades, fuel and fireworks. Sporting equipment like ice skates, and items that could harm other people, such as swords and batons, won’t be allowed on board either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your goal here is to be as comfortable as you can. Dress in loose, breathable clothing and remember to pack a pullover just in case you get chilly. Pick a pair of roomy, flat shoes as your feet may swell during the journey. Leave the high heels and chunky boots in your luggage.
  • The condition known as DVT (deep vein thrombosis) is a potential risk on long-haul flights. It’s the result of blood clots forming due to poor circulation and inactivity. Doing regular foot and leg exercises while seated helps to prevent this happening. Wearing a high-quality pair of compression socks or tights also helps reduce your ris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Montagne?
Being prepared before you arrive at the airport will help make your trip to Montagne quick and painless. Below you’ll find some handy hints for a speedy journey through security:

  • Be sure to keep your ID and boarding pass within easy reach. They’re the first things you’ll be asked to show at airport security.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Empty your pockets and remove anything that is likely to beep. This includes items like earphones or headphones, as well as heavy jackets or coats. They’ll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• For just a few moments, you’ll have to unplug from the digital world. Your phone, laptop and any other electronic gadgets will also need to go through the scanner.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as lip balm or cologne, that you want to bring on board need to be in containers no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). They must also all f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• There’s a chance you’ll be required to take your shoes off for scanning, so wearing slip-on sneakers is always a wise idea.
  • Airlines won’t allow any sharp objects in your carry-on baggage. If you need to bring these kinds of items, put them in your checked luggage.
